Essoyes

Essoyes (French pronunciation: [ɛswa]) is a commune in the Aube department in north-central France.

Essoyes is a quiet Champagne village located about thirty miles south of Troyes, on the banks of the Ource river.

The existence of inhabitants at the site of Essoyes on the Ource river can be traced as far back as the time of the Celts.

At the center of the town once stood the ancient church of Saint-Remi, among the most remarkable Romanesque buildings in the Aube.
